I am currently looking to buy a 3 BHK flat. When I started searching, one of the first things I wanted to know was 3 BHK how many square feet? From what I found online, a standard 3 BHK is usually between 1200 to 1500 square feet. That is usually enough for three bedrooms, a living area, dining space, kitchen, and two bathrooms. I also came across other size options for 3 BHK flats, which I have shared below.
3 BHK is How Many Square Feet is Required?
From what I have seen during my search for a 3 BHK, the size really depends on the location and type of property. Here is what I have noticed.
In cities, most 3 BHK flats are around 1,000 to 1,500 sq ft. They are compact but usually designed to make good use of space.
In suburban or slightly outskirt areas, I have come across options ranging from 1,500 to 2,500 sq. ft, which feel more spacious.
Luxury ones go even bigger, some I saw were over 2,000 sq. ft. with extra features like big balconies, more bathrooms, or a terrace.

The minimum square feet for 3 BHK required is 1200 sq ft - 1500 sq ft. Actually the size will depend on several factors like-
How spacious rooms you want
You want a balcony or not
Whether to include a puja room, servant room or more space in the house or not and more.
